Chicago Opera Theater Chicago Opera Theater expands the tradition of opera as a living art form. COT enriches the lives of children and youth through participatory arts programming.

Chicago Opera Theater expands the tradition of opera as a living art form by engaging lovers of music and storytelling through innovative experiences predominantly of new and rarely performed works. COT opens the doors to opera through accessible performances and a welcoming environment. COT is a platform for the next generation of artists in the opera field to grow and launch professional careers

. COT connects emotionally and intellectually with a broad and diverse Chicago audience through collaboration with our community.

We are deeply saddened by the loss of civil rights activist Claudette Colvin. Chicago Opera Theater shared her story through our recent opera ‘She Who Dared, — which honored the women who came before Rosa Parks during the 1950s Montgomery bus boycotts.

We are deeply grateful to have had the opportunity to bring her story to Chicago audiences and to honor her life and legacy as a pioneering force in the civil rights movement.

Experience 'In America’s Embrace' — a Discovery Concert celebrating immigrant composers whose voices helped transform American music on January 18. 🇺🇸🎶

Featuring works by Kurt Weill, Irving Berlin, Erich Wolfgang Korngold, Igor Stravinsky, André Previn, Osvaldo Golijov, Aleksandra Vrebalov, and more, this stirring program honors artists who sought refuge in America — redefining our culture through bold creativity and music!
